Twilio Falls 1.85% on Competitive Pressures as $230M Volume Ranks 490th
On September 25, 2025, TwilioTWLO-- (TWLO) closed down 1.85% with a trading volume of $230 million, ranking 490th in market activity among U.S.-listed stocks. The decline followed mixed signals from recent developments in the communications platform sector.
Analysts noted that Twilio’s performance was impacted by ongoing competitive pressures in the cloud messaging space, as rivals continue to expand their API offerings. While the company has maintained its leadership in programmable communications, recent earnings reports highlighted margin compression due to aggressive pricing strategies in the market. Investors appeared cautious, with volume remaining below its 30-day average despite the stock’s recent consolidation pattern.
